Congratulations and Thank You: 2009!

Thank you Zia and Peter

Running for AVUKAV parents Zia and Peter and their team from the DAC ran to raise money for AVUK!

Zia says "I cannot begin to describe how it felt when our darling daughter, Alisha, was diagnosed as deaf. The grief and despair were overwhelming. All we wanted was that she be given the tools to fulfil her own potential, AVUK gave us those tools.

I knew we had reached a point I could not have imagined when, on a flight, after several hours of non-stop talking I had to tell Alisha that there was to be no more talking or there would be big trouble.

Alisha is now in a mainstream school, participates fully and has no trouble keeping up (she also does not stop talking and sings beautifully). That would not have been possible for her without auditory verbal therapy.

Please help us continue AVUK's work so that all deaf children can have the opportunity that Alisha has had." read more...

AVUK would like to send a very special thank you to Francesca Woolgar. Over the last few years Francesca has been a constant supporter of AVUK. In addition to organising numerous fundraising ventures she has donated toys and many hours of her time to us. We have so appreciated having her help out at the centre on bank holidays and during the school holidays, and she has been invaluable in running creches for our AV children at the summer picnics. We are particularly impressed by the way Francesca has inspired others to get involved in helping us too! Thanks to Francesca we are supported by a group of several young people who not only come along to help with the creches but also go off and undertake their own fundraising ventures. Thank you Frannie!
